Introduction to the PCT Rapid Test Kit Market
Procalcitonin rapid test kits represent a vital innovation in the diagnostic landscape, offering clinicians timely insights into the presence and severity of bacterial infections and sepsis. By quantifying procalcitonin levels within minutes rather than hours, these kits enable healthcare professionals to tailor antibiotic therapy more precisely, curb unnecessary antimicrobial use, and improve patient outcomes. As healthcare systems worldwide confront rising sepsis-related morbidity, burgeoning antibiotic resistance, and mounting pressure to optimize resource utilization, the demand for fast, reliable PCT assays has surged. Furthermore, the shift toward decentralized testing-driven by the need for rapid decision-making in emergency departments and point-of-care settings-has elevated the strategic importance of portable and user-friendly diagnostics. Transformative Shifts Reshaping the PCT Rapid Test Landscape
The landscape of procalcitonin rapid testing has experienced several transformative shifts in recent years. First, advances in immunoassay methodologies-such as fluorescence immunoassays and lateral flow formats-and integration with microfluidic and biosensor technologies have driven improvements in sensitivity, specificity, and time-to-result. In parallel, the proliferation of digital health platforms and smartphone connectivity has enabled seamless data capture and remote monitoring, empowering clinicians to make informed decisions from anywhere.
Second, the COVID-19 pandemic accelerated decentralized testing adoption, exposing bottlenecks in centralized laboratories and catalyzing investment in point-of-care solutions. Emergency departments and outpatient clinics, in particular, have embraced immediate testing solutions to triage patients rapidly, reduce hospital stays, and minimize cross-infection risks. This shift has spurred suppliers to design compact, easy-to-use kits tailored for non-laboratory environments.
Third, antimicrobial stewardship programs have elevated procalcitonin as a critical biomarker for guiding antibiotic initiation and discontinuation. Updated clinical guidelines in major healthcare systems now endorse PCT-guided protocols, creating a solid reimbursement foundation and bolstering demand among hospitals and diagnostic laboratories.
Finally, regulatory landscapes have evolved to fast-track innovative diagnostics, with agencies introducing expedited pathways for tests that address urgent clinical needs. As a result, manufacturers and research institutions are collaborating on next-generation rapid assays that leverage nano-biosensors, droplet-based microfluidics, and automated readers. Together, these shifts are redefining how, where, and when procalcitonin testing occurs, paving the way for sustained market growth and enhanced patient care.
Cumulative Impact of United States Tariffs in 2025 on PCT Rapid Kits
Beginning in 2025, a new wave of United States tariffs on imported diagnostic components and finished test kits is poised to reshape supply chains and cost structures across the procalcitonin rapid test sector. Raw materials sourced from established overseas suppliers will face increased duties, driving up input costs for both kit manufacturers and reagent producers. Consequently, companies that rely heavily on offshore production may experience margin compression unless they negotiate favorable terms or absorb costs internally.
At the same time, these tariffs create a strategic impetus for near-shoring and domestic manufacturing. Some global players are already expanding local production capacities or forging partnerships with US-based contract manufacturers to mitigate tariff exposure and shorten lead times. Such moves not only guard against cost volatility but also align with broader regulatory and security priorities, enhancing supply chain resilience.
Moreover, pricing pressures stemming from higher import duties may spur innovation in reagent efficiency and alternative material sourcing. Research institutions and private research firms are exploring cost-effective assay chemistries and modular cartridge designs to offset tariff impacts without sacrificing performance. Meanwhile, distribution channels-from hospital pharmacies to e-commerce platforms-are reevaluating procurement strategies, seeking bundled contracts and volume discounts to maintain stable pricing for end-users.
In this evolving context, stakeholders that proactively address tariff-induced headwinds by diversifying sourcing, investing in domestic capabilities, and optimizing cost structures will secure a competitive advantage. Conversely, firms that delay strategic adjustments risk eroded profitability, supply disruptions, and diminished market share.
Key Insights from Comprehensive Market Segmentation
A nuanced understanding of market segmentation is critical for stakeholders aiming to align product portfolios with end-user needs. From a product type perspective, serum-based kits-encompassing enzyme-linked immunosorbent assays and fluorescence immunoassays-remain the gold standard in centralized laboratories, whereas urine-based formats, which leverage immunochromatographic assays and lateral flow assays, are gaining traction in outpatient settings due to ease of sample collection. Simultaneously, whole blood-based kits utilizing chromatographic immunoassays and latex agglutination tests cater to point-of-care environments, delivering rapid results from capillary or venous blood samples.
Distribution channels underscore the dichotomy between traditional and digital pathways. Offline retail continues to rely on hospital pharmacies and retail pharmacies for bulk procurement and integration into clinical workflows, while online retail-comprising e-commerce stores and manufacturer websites-offers convenience and direct access for smaller clinics, home care providers, and research laboratories seeking just-in-time shipments.
End-user segmentation further illuminates demand drivers. Diagnostic laboratories, including both hospital laboratories and independent laboratories, prioritize high-throughput kits and automated platforms that support standardized testing protocols. Hospitals and clinics, spanning emergency departments, inpatient departments, and outpatient departments, require versatile solutions that adapt to fluctuating patient volumes and clinical urgency. Research institutions-whether in academic research bodies, government research agencies, or private research firms-place a premium on flexible assay configurations that facilitate method development and biomarker discovery.
Test timeliness differentiates immediate testing solutions and point-of-care testing from standard PCT protocols with regular turnaround, enabling clinicians to escalate or de-escalate care pathways within critical time windows. Application-based segmentation highlights focused use cases: respiratory bacterial infections and sepsis detection drive demand in acute care, post-operative sepsis monitoring and surgical site infection tracking bolster surgical wards, and flu outbreak management and hepatitis surveillance support infectious disease control programs.
On the technology front, biosensor platforms-spanning molecular biosensors and nano-biosensors-offer high sensitivity in miniaturized formats, while microfluidic approaches, whether continuous-flow microfluidics or droplet-based systems, facilitate sample processing and multiplexed analyses. Usability considerations split the market between home use kits, which emphasize easy-to-use, single-step procedures for non-professional users, and professional use kits, which incorporate multi-step protocols and require certified training to ensure consistent results. Finally, kit characteristics range from multi-parameter test kits that deliver a broader biomarker spectrum for comprehensive disease detection to single parameter test kits focused on specific biomarkers, enabling lean testing algorithms when clinical suspicion is narrow.

Regional Dynamics Driving the PCT Rapid Test Market
Regional dynamics exert a profound influence on adoption patterns and competitive strategies. In the Americas, well-established reimbursement frameworks and advanced diagnostic infrastructures underpin early adoption of PCT rapid test kits. Nationwide antimicrobial stewardship initiatives and patient-centered care models drive end-users to integrate procalcitonin testing into sepsis management protocols, especially in emergency departments and intensive care units.
Moving to Europe, Middle East & Africa, diverse regulatory environments and heterogeneous healthcare financing structures create both complexity and opportunity. Countries with centralized procurement and strong public–private partnerships tend to standardize on a limited set of validated PCT platforms, while emerging markets within the region are witnessing accelerated demand as governments invest in infection control and laboratory modernization. Local distributors often play a pivotal role in navigating regulatory requirements and delivering training to clinical staff.
In the Asia-Pacific region, rapid healthcare expenditure growth, urbanization, and heightened awareness of sepsis burden are fueling market expansion. Government initiatives aimed at strengthening primary care and expanding point-of-care testing networks have rendered portable PCT rapid kits indispensable in rural clinics and community health centers. Moreover, cost-sensitive markets are fostering competition among manufacturers to offer scalable solutions that balance affordability with clinical performance.

Strategic Developments Among Leading Market Players
Leading players are continuously refining their strategies to capture market share and drive innovation. Abbott Laboratories has focused on expanding its point-of-care immunoassay portfolio and enhancing connectivity features for seamless data integration. Anova Diagnostics Inc. leverages niche expertise in lateral flow immunoassays to deliver cost-effective urine-based PCT tests, while bioMérieux emphasizes partnerships with hospital networks to support integrated sepsis management platforms.
Getein Biotech Inc. and HYCOR Biomedical have each intensified R&D in nano-biosensor technologies, targeting ultra-low detection limits and rapid turnaround times. Roche Diagnostics continues to consolidate its leadership through strategic acquisitions and by optimizing reagent supply chains, and Sekisui Diagnostics LLC is advancing multianalyte cartridge systems that streamline workflow in high-volume laboratories.
Siemens Healthineers has invested heavily in microfluidic innovations and digital health integrations, positioning its PCT assays within broader point-of-care ecosystems. Thermo Fisher Scientific Inc. and Thermo Scientific have leveraged their global distribution networks and extensive portfolio of research reagents to support both professional and home use segments. Collectively, these companies are shaping the competitive environment through technological differentiation, strategic alliances, and expanded manufacturing footprints.
